Credit Card Sized Land Nav Compass: What It Is and Why Navigators Carry One

A credit card sized land navigation compass is exactly what it sounds like — a flat, wallet-sized compass engineered to fit in a pocket, a map case, or tucked behind a morale patch. But despite its minimal footprint, this tool carries real utility for hikers, military personnel, scouts, and anyone who works with topographic maps in the field.

What Is a Credit Card Sized Land Nav Compass?

A land navigation compass — often called a "lensatic" or "baseplate" compass depending on its design — is used to orient maps, shoot azimuths, and determine direction of travel relative to magnetic north. The credit card version scales this functionality down to roughly 85mm × 54mm, the same dimensions as a standard payment card.

These compasses are typically made from transparent or semi-transparent plastic with a rotating bezel, printed degree markings, and a magnetized needle or card. The transparency is intentional — it lets you lay the compass directly over a printed map and align grid lines without lifting the tool off the paper.

Some models include:

  • Millimeter rulers along the edges for measuring map distances
  • Declination adjustment scales to account for the difference between magnetic north and true north
  • Magnifying lenses for reading fine map detail
  • Romer scales for plotting UTM grid coordinates

They're not typically filled with liquid damping fluid the way larger field compasses are, which affects how quickly the needle settles — more on that below.

How a Credit Card Compass Differs from Standard Field Compasses

Understanding the tradeoffs helps you set accurate expectations.

The key limitation of a dry-needle credit card compass is needle oscillation — without damping fluid, the needle takes longer to stabilize, which matters when you need a quick, accurate bearing in moving conditions. For stationary map work and general land navigation, this is rarely a problem.

What Makes a Credit Card Compass Useful for Land Nav Specifically?

Land navigation — the practice of using a map and compass to move through terrain — depends on a specific set of skills: orienting the map, shooting an azimuth, triangulating position, and following a bearing. A credit card compass supports all of these when used correctly.

🗺️ Because the baseplate is transparent, you can:

  1. Align the compass edge along a desired route on the map
  2. Rotate the bezel until the orienting lines match the map's north lines
  3. Read the bearing directly from the index line
  4. Follow that bearing in the field

This workflow is identical to what you'd do with a full-sized baseplate compass. The credit card form factor doesn't change the method — it just changes where you carry it.

Declination is a critical variable here. Magnetic north and true north diverge by an amount that varies by geographic location and changes slowly over time. Any serious land nav use requires knowing your local declination and either adjusting your compass mechanically (if it supports it) or applying a manual correction. A compass without declination adjustment markings requires you to do the math yourself — which is doable, but adds a step.

Who Uses Credit Card Sized Land Nav Compasses?

These tools appeal to a specific user profile:

  • Military and ROTC personnel who carry them as a backup to a primary lensatic compass
  • Thru-hikers and ultralight backpackers who prioritize weight and packability above all
  • Preppers and EDC (everyday carry) enthusiasts who want a compact emergency navigation tool
  • Map and compass instructors who issue them to students as affordable learning tools
  • Orienteering participants for casual course work

They're generally not the first choice for high-stakes wilderness navigation where precision, durability, and fast readings under stress are essential. For that use case, most experienced navigators reach for a quality baseplate or lensatic compass and relegate the card compass to backup status.

Factors That Determine Usefulness for Your Situation

Whether a credit card compass serves you well depends on several variables that only you can assess:

Navigation precision required — Casual trail hiking has a wider margin for error than off-trail mountain navigation or military land nav exercises with tight tolerances.

Environment — Cold weather makes plastic brittle. High humidity can fog optics or warp card stock. Extreme conditions favor more robust instruments.

Primary vs. backup role — Carried as a redundant tool alongside a quality primary compass, almost any credit card model adds value. Relied on as your sole navigation instrument in serious terrain, the limitations become more significant.

Map scale you're working with — The ruler markings on a card compass are only useful if they match your map's scale. A 1:25,000 map and a 1:50,000 map require different Romer scales.

Your navigation skill level — A compass is only as accurate as the person using it. 🧭 The card format offers no shortcuts around understanding declination, back-azimuths, and resection.
